Fabrication industrielle
Internet des objets industriel | Matériaux industriels | Entretien et réparation d'équipement | Programmation industrielle |
home  MfgRobots >> Fabrication industrielle >  >> Manufacturing Technology >> Processus de fabrication

Contrôle d'accès avec QR, RFID et vérification de la température

Ce prototype Raspi lit QR et RFID, vérifie la température des invités et s'authentifie à distance pour accorder l'accès par barrière.

Le monde post Covid-19 s’est avéré un peu différent. Désormais, avant d'autoriser l'accès à certains quartiers privés, entreprises et écoles, un contrôle de température est obligatoire.

Cette unité basée sur Raspberry Pi lit les codes QR ou les cartes RFID, puis vérifie la température des invités, s'authentifie auprès d'un serveur distant et accorde un accès barrière.

Comment ça marche ?

Le prototype utilise Raspberry Pi 4 avec un module de came, un lecteur RFID, un capteur de température IR et un relais 4 canaux connectés. Pour la démo, un servomoteur agit comme une barrière mais dans le monde réel, tout type de combinaison de barrière peut être activé.

Le logiciel a été programmé à l'aide de Python avec le flux suivant :

1. La caméra prend un instantané en utilisant une LED lumineuse comme flash (juste au cas où le QR serait imprimé sur du papier au lieu d'un écran de smartphone)

2. Si aucun QR n'est détecté, l'unité essaie de lire RFID

3. QR est décodé, donc à ce stade, le code QR invité ou le code RFID invité est disponible

4. Le capteur de température IR situé à droite lit la température écrite par l'invité

5. Le code invité + la température sont envoyés à un serveur distant où un script PHP écoute les requêtes

6. Une réponse est renvoyée à l'unité avec les relais à activer (barrières, etc.)

7. Une base de données est remplie avec toutes les demandes et accès à des fins de rapport

Démo

Notes techniques

La principale raison d'utiliser Raspberry Pi au lieu d'Arduino était le lecteur de code QR. Il existe plusieurs bibliothèques QR qui peuvent être utilisées avec Raspbian et Python pour décoder les QR mais vous devrez faire quelques ajustements.

Les deux capteurs de température IR MLX90614 et PN532 utilisent I2c. Ils ont une adresse différente - vérifiée avec sudo i2cdetect -y 1- donc il vous suffit de connecter les câbles en parallèle et c'est tout.

extraits de code

Scannez le code QR avec Raspberry

 camera=picamera.PiCamera() 
camera.resolution =(800, 600)
camera.color_effects =(128,128)
camera.capture('qr/'+str(counter)+'.jpg')
camera.close()

Interroger le serveur distant

 url ='http://IPHere/qr.php' 
myobj ={'qr':myData,'temp':str(temp)} essayez :
x = requests.post(url, data =myobj)

Lire NFC depuis Raspberry PI

pour la cible dans n.poll() :
essayez :
nfcData=target.uid

Source :Contrôle d'accès avec QR, RFID et vérification de la température


Processus de fabrication

  1. Synopsys permet des conceptions multi-dies avec IP HBM3 et vérification
  2. Mesure des températures avec un capteur DS18B20 1 fil et Raspberry Pi
  3. Lire la température avec DS18B20 | Raspberry Pi 2
  4. Mesure de la température avec RASPBERRY PI
  5. Contrôle de la température avec Raspberry Pi
  6. Capteur de température et de luminosité Raspberry Pi
  7. Contrôle du capteur et de l'actionneur Raspberry Pi
  8. Contrôle et influence de la température pendant le processus de moulage sous pression
  9. Contrôle des caractéristiques du tour à banc incliné avec graphiques de vérification